Flow Stress in Submicron BCC Iron Single Crystals: Sample-size-dependent Strain-rate Sensitivity and Rate-dependent Size Strengthening

Through in situ scanning electron microscope microcompression tests, we demonstrated that the strain-rate sensitivity of body-centered cubic single crystal iron pillars will be reduced by one order when the pillar size was reduced from 1000 to about 200 nm.
